Kredi Karti Mesaj Uyarisi

z3ys3ha

OpenCart-TR
Katılım
8 Eki 2011
Mesajlar
80
Tepkime puanı
0
Puanları
0
Merhaba Arkadaslar,

Kredi kart cekiminde müsterinin kartinda yeterli limit olmamasi durumun bu durumu belirten sayfa yada uyari yazisi müsterinin sayfasinda cikmiyor. Sadece tekrardan kasaya yönlendiriyor. Islem basarisiz veya kredi kartinizda limit yok uyarisi cikmiyor. Bu uyariyi nasil yapabilirim fikri olan var mi. Simdiden Tskler.
 

byoracle

OpenCart-TR
Katılım
19 Ağu 2010
Mesajlar
27
Tepkime puanı
0
Puanları
0
Konum
İstanbul
Alıntıdır.
Kaynak; http://www.duzgun.com/opencart-hazir-projeler/-guncelleme-opencart-wpos-pro-v2-t-3611.html

(Güncelleme) Opencart WPos Pro v2
Opencart 1.5+ sürümlerinde webpos pro v2 kullanıcıları hata iletilerini alamamaktaydılar. Bunun nedeni 1.4 sürümü içinde hata ileti çıktıları hazır olarak opencartta bulunurken, 1.5+ da bu özelliğin bulunmamasıdır.

Opencart 1.5+ daki bu eksiklik, 1.5+ nın kendi bug ı olarak değerlendirilmelidir.

Bu konuyada çözüm üreterek 1.5+ kullanıcıları için hata iletileri kolay anlamaları ve farketmelerini sağlayan bir yöntemle sunmaktayız.

1.5+ sürümlerde aşağıdaki değişikliği yapmanız önemle rica olunur.

\catalog\view\theme\default\template\checkout\checkout.tpl

dosyası açılacak

PHP Kod:
<?php echo $header; ?>

kodundan sonra açağıdaki kod eklenecek.

PHP Kod:
<?php if(isset($_SESSION['error']) && $_SESSION['error']!=""){?>
<script>
$(function() {
$("#dialog:ui-dialog").dialog("destroy");
$("#dialog-message").dialog({modal:true,buttons:{Ok:function(){$(this).dialog("close");}}});});
</script>
<div id="dialog-message" title="!"><p><span class="ui-icon ui-icon-circle-check" style="float:left; margin:0 7px 50px 0;"></span>
<?php
echo $_SESSION['error'];
unset($_SESSION['error']);
?></p></div><?php } ?>

Bu şekilde v2 deki hatalar görüntülenebilecek.
 
Üst